Unified Power Flow Controller (UPFC) is most important device which used to help in damping out the oscillations which present in the system. UPFC device is the most flexible FACTS equipments. UPFC execute the combined functions of the controlled reactor (TCR), static synchronous compensator (STATCOM), thyristor controlled reactor (TCR), thyristor switched capacitor (TSC). By using this device the phase angle regulator offers the flexibility for the dynamic and static operation of the power network. In the transmission line all the electrical variable can be controlled by the FACTS device. By the use of FACTS we can control various applications concerned of the power system, like power flow scheduling; power oscillations damping and enhancing the transient stability. We are present here the studies & result on FACTS devic & their impact of oscillations on power system. In the FACTS device one important tool UPFC device which have capability to control independent true power & active power . By use of this device reliability & quality of supply of system can be improvised. Various types of oscillations as consequence & interaction of its component in power system. Worldwide the most common oscillations that is observed is electromechanically oscillations in power system. Oscillations may occurs because of many reason such as change of load, disturbances in network , fault in the system etc. Here we studied about smooth power flow control, transient stability and how to enhancement it, stability of small disturbance for small time & improvement and oscillation damping in the system. In the family of FACTS device UPFC have flexible characteristics.
